### 🏕️ Introduction / Overview: Full-Service Camping Below Melvern Lake Dam
For Kansas campers who prioritize modern amenities alongside natural beauty, **Outlet Park Campground (Melvern)** is truly a standout destination. Situated in a scenic area below the impressive Melvern Lake Dam on the eastern edge of the famous Flint Hills, this U.S. Army Corps of Engineers (COE) park offers a superior camping experience, particularly for RV enthusiasts. Unlike many traditional lake campgrounds, Outlet Park is renowned for providing a substantial number of **full hookup (FHU) sites**, which include water, electricity, and sewer connections, making for an effortless and comfortable stay.
This is a large, well-organized facility designed to maximize guest comfort and recreational access. It is set around the beautiful and scenic Melvern River Pond, which offers its own unique ecosystem and dedicated activities, separate from the main lake body. Customer reviews frequently highlight the park's exceptional quality, describing it as a "fantastic COE campground" with "super clean facilities" and large, paved sites. It has earned a reputation among local Kansas users as a quiet, surprisingly wonderful place to stay that offers "a good price" for fishing, kayaking, bike riding, and family fun. For those seeking the convenience of a modern RV park blended with the peace of a natural setting, Outlet Park is an essential choice in the Kansas camping circuit.

### Location and Accessibility: Melvern Lake's River Pond Area
Outlet Park Campground is strategically positioned in a beautiful and easily accessible location in Eastern Kansas. Its official mailing address is **River Pond Prkwy, Melvern, KS 66510, USA**. The park is situated specifically below the Melvern Lake Dam in the Marais des Cygnes River Valley, a setting that provides plenty of shade and a unique, pond-centric water experience.
The location offers excellent access via major state highways, making it a convenient drive for residents across the region. It is close to the junction of US-75 and K-31, a crucial highway that links the area to larger supply centers. Despite its seclusion beneath the dam, the campground is only a short drive from the small town of Melvern and just about ten minutes north to Lyndon, KS, where campers can find local services like a Dollar General for quick grocery and supply runs. The campground itself is arranged in various loops (including Loops A, B, and C) around the tranquil Melvern River Pond, with paved roads for easy navigation and large, paved sites situated for easy back-in, accommodating RVs up to 75 feet in length. Its location below the dam often grants it a quiet atmosphere, as noted by visitors who appreciate the "virtually no road noise."

Giant campsites in A loop with an excellent bathroom and shower house but not any shade. C loop has great shade and sites are average size. B loop reminds me a typical rv park with slanted pull through sites that are fairly close together but has a really nice shower house too and is close to the boat ramp.
Beautiful area! The restrooms/bathhouses are well maintained. There is also a path around the outlet (~2 miles) that is so peaceful & pretty. Lots of rangers around to ask questions about wildlife or the park, or give directions to open boat docks.
